- For the Philly Cheesesteaks
- 1½ pounds 680 g ribeye steak, thinly sliced (or sirloin if preferred)
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
- 1 large yellow onion thinly sliced
- 1 green bell pepper thinly sliced (optional)
- 8 ounces 225 g mushrooms, sliced (optional)
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- ½ teaspoon onion powder
- ½ teaspoon smoked paprika optional
- Salt to taste
- Black pepper to taste
- 8 slices provolone cheese or American cheese, or Cheez Whiz for a traditional variation
- 4 hoagie rolls or Italian sandwich rolls
- 1 tablespoon butter softened (for toasting the rolls)
